    Abstract: A vehicle heat management system includes a refrigerant circuit, a heating circuit, a battery temperature regulation circuit, and an electric part cooling circuit. The refrigerant circuit is configured to circulate a refrigerant to regulate a temperature inside a passenger compartment therethrough. The heating circuit is configured to circulate a liquid that exchanges heat with the refrigerant therethrough. The heating circuit is capable of regulating the temperature inside the passenger compartment. The battery temperature regulation circuit is configured to regulate a temperature of a battery by introducing a liquid that exchanges heat with the refrigerant to the battery. The electric part cooling circuit is couplable to the battery temperature regulation circuit and configured to circulate a liquid able to cool an electric part for driving a vehicle therethrough.

    Abstract: A vehicle includes a first power system, a second power system, a switching relay, and a relay controller. The first power system is coupled to an engine restart motor. The second power system is provided independently of the first power system and is coupled to a starter and an accessory. The coupling state of the switching relay is switchable to an on state in which the first power system and the second power system are coupled, and to an off state in which the first power system and the second power system are not coupled. The relay controller is configured to receive a supply of electric power from both the first power system and the second power system and to control the coupling state of the switching relay.

    Abstract: A waste heat recovering and cooling apparatus for an engine includes a water pump that ejects cooling water of an engine; an EGR cooler that cools EGR gas introduced into an intake pipe from an exhaust pipe of the engine by using some of the cooling water ejected from the water pump; an EGR valve that opens and closes the channel of the EGR gas passing through the EGR cooler; and a transmission warmer that heats lubricating oil of a transmission by the cooling water passing through the EGR cooler.
